Physical Descriptions
- Medium
- Wood-block printed accordion-fold book mounted as a handscroll; with printed illustrations hand-painted with red pigment in selected areas at a later date; ink and color on paper
- Dimensions
-
overall (approx.): H. 29.2 × W. 1344.5 cm (11 1/2 × 529 5/16 in.)
printed sutra only (approx.): H. 29.2 × W. 1153 cm (11 1/2 × 453 15/16 in.)
Provenance
- Recorded Ownership History
- Philip Hofer (1898-1984), Cambridge, MA, purchased from Tokyo dealer Sorimachi, November 1959; bequest to Harvard Art Museums
